Mystery wrote:
This issue has already been present for some Vista computers, how about if you ignore it, and then register it manually?
http://www.adventuremaker.com/phpBB2/viewtopic.php?p=9795#9795

Does that work?

EDIT
Just have seen that it didn't work for Doggy Confused

Okay, seen someone suggesting this:
After installation, first unregister it, then register it.

RegSvr32 msdxm6.ocx /U
Then
Regsvr32 msdxm6.ocx

I'm pretty sure that it's a permission issue...



I have tried this but i'm unaable to register it manually.
The unregistration works, but then I can't register it again.

If I ignore the failure at the installing I can't get a game to work Sad

Does anyone also have problems to install the 4.6.0 version on windows7?

The 4.5.2 Version runs fine!

Anyone have an idea?

Yes. I made realplayer as my standard mediaplayer so I have no issues with sound. Perhaps this is the reason why I cant get register the ocx file? I have uninstalled Windows Mediaplayer. I will try it later on with installed Mediaplayer.

Edit: Ok it has realy to do with the mediaplayer.If the player is activated, there is no problem to install the new version Smile

I have just tested my old project on windows 7 with new 4.6 version.
It works, BUT as GM support said, this new version doesn't support the variations of volume and the fade in and fade out sounds. It 's a big problem for me because I have lot of music in my project sounds ambiance. Now the music begins and finishes brutally and cover the channel where I putted voices. I can't export the project like that.

May I hope this problem will be resolved in future?

I am having this issue, as well. What I ended up doing was opening all of the game's audio files in audio software (such as Adobe Audition). From there, I mixed everything down to the appropriate levels, so dialog was louder than background ambience, etc. Then I re-saved the files.

With over 300 audio files, it was a pain...but it worked.
